144
145 // Add details in Header
146 func (s *Server) middlewareXDSDetails() gin.HandlerFunc {
147         return func(c *gin.Context) {
148                 c.Header("XDS-Version", s.cfg.Version)
149                 c.Header("XDS-API-Version", s.cfg.APIVersion)
150                 c.Next()
151         }
152 }
153
154 // CORS middleware
155 func (s *Server) middlewareCORS() gin.HandlerFunc {
156         return func(c *gin.Context) {
157
158                 if c.Request.Method == "OPTIONS" {
159                         c.Header("Access-Control-Allow-Origin", "*")
160                         c.Header("Access-Control-Allow-Headers", "Content-Type")
161                         c.Header("Access-Control-Allow-Methods", "POST, DELETE, GET, PUT")
162                         c.Header("Content-Type", "application/json")
163                         c.Header("Access-Control-Max-Age", cookieMaxAge)
164                         c.AbortWithStatus(204)
165                         return
166                 }
167
168                 c.Next()
169         }
